要优化WordPress的缓存设置以提高网站性能,请按照以下步骤操作:,1. 安装缓存插件:使用W3 Total Cache、WP Super Cache等缓存插件,以缓存页面内容、查询结果和CSS文件。,2. 选择缓存类型:选择合适的缓存类型,如页面缓存、对象缓存和API缓存,以提高不同方面的性能。,3. 配置缓存设置:根据网站需求调整缓存过期时间、动态内容处理等设置。,4. 使用CDN缓存:将静态资源放在CDN上,加快访问速度。,5. 优化数据库查询:减少数据库查询次数,提高网站性能。,通过安装缓存插件、选择合适的缓存类型和配置缓存设置等方法,可以显著提高WordPress网站的性能。
随着互联网技术的快速发展,人们对网站访问速度和用户体验的要求也越来越高,作为博客、电商或企业网站的主要搭建平台,WordPress在面临海量数据和高并发访问的情况下,如何优化其缓存设置以提高网站性能成为了亟待解决的问题。
什么是WordPress缓存
WordPress缓存主要是通过将网页内容、数据库查询结果等保存在服务器端的缓存系统中,从而减少对后端服务器的请求次数,加快页面的加载速度,合理的缓存策略对于提升WordPress网站的性能至关重要。
优化WordPress缓存设置的常用方法
-
启用浏览器缓存
通过设置
EXTRAHeaders插件或直接在主题文件中添加meta标签来控制浏览器的缓存行为,这可以减少用户不必要的网络请求和数据传输。 -
使用Redis缓存插件
安装并配置适用于WordPress的Redis缓存插件,如WP Super Cache、W3 Total Cache等,这些插件可以将动态内容生成后缓存在Redis数据库中,实现高效的缓存机制。
-
数据库查询缓存
开启WordPress默认的查询缓存功能,并考虑对频繁执行的查询进行手动缓存,这可以显著减少数据库查询次数,但请注意,对于实时性要求高的数据或不经常变化的数据,不要使用查询缓存。
-
优化图片和代码
压缩图片大小,选择合适的图片格式,使用CSS Sprites合并多个小图标为一个大图,从而降低服务器的负担,简化HTML、CSS和JavaScript代码,移除不必要的空格和注释,也有助于提升网站的性能。
-
使用CDN加速
部署到内容分发网络(CDN)上,利用CDN的全球分布式服务器加速静态资源的访问速度。
-
合理配置服务器参数
根据服务器的实际性能和业务需求调整服务器参数,如PHP内存限制、上传文件大小限制等,以提高网站的吞吐量。
如何选择合适的缓存插件
在众多WordPress缓存插件中,用户需要根据自己的实际需求和系统配置进行选择,对于需要高并发处理能力的网站,可以选择具有更优分布式缓存的插件;而对于主要提供静态内容的网站,则可以选择简单的页面缓存插件。
优化WordPress的缓存设置是提升网站性能的关键环节之一,通过采用合适的缓存策略和技术手段,可以有效减少服务器负担、加快页面加载速度、提升用户体验,并为网站的长远发展奠定坚实基础。